Network Connection Problems (Scan)
Cause Solution Reference
Using a cross cable. Use a straight cable. -
The machine was turned on before a
cable was connected.
Connect cables before turning the
machine on.
Connecting a LAN Cable/USB
Cable (User's Manual)
There is a problem with the
compatibility with the hub.
Press the (SETTING) button
on the operator panel, select [Admin
Setup] > [Network Menu] > [Network
Setup] > [Network Setting] > [HUB
Link Setting], and then change the
setting.
-
The network connection setting is
incorrect.
To connect to a wired network, set
[Wired] for the network connection to
[Enable].

Cause Solution Reference
The IP address is incorrect. • Check that the same IP address is
set for the machine and the
machine's port setting on the
computer.
• Check that the IP address is not
duplicated by another device.
• Check that the correct IP address,
subnet mask, and gateway address
are set.
• If using OKI LPR Utility, check the
IP address setting with OKI LPR
Utility.
